FALCON & FALCON XL

USER'S GUIDE

MOTION SENSORS FOR INDUSTRIAL DOORS

FALCON: for high mounting • FALCON XL: for low mounting

Technology: Microwave and microprocessor
Transmitter frequency:

24.125 GHz

Transmitter radiated power: <20 dBm EIRP
Transmitter power density: < 5 mW/cm²
Mounting height

FALCON: from 11.5 to 23’

FALCON XL: from 6.5 to 11.5’

Tilt angle:

0° to 180° in elevation

Detection zone (typical)

Wide pattern (FALCON XL): 13’ (W) x 6.5’ (D)

for a mounting height of 8.2’

Narrow pattern (FALCON): 13’ (W) x 16’ (D)

for a mounting height of 16’

Detection mode:

movement

Minimum detection speed:

2.2 in/s (measured in the
sensor axis)

Supply voltage:

12V to 24V AC +/- 10%

12V to 24V DC +30% / -10%

Mains frequency:

50 to 60 Hz

Power consumption: <

2W

Output relay: free of potential changeover contact

Max contact voltage : 42V AC/ DC

Max contact current: 1A (resistive)

Max switching power: 30W (DC) / 60 VA (AC)

Hold time: 0.5s to 9s (adjustable)
Manual adjustment:

• orientation of sensing field (mechanically)
• multiple functions (by push buttons).

Remote control adjustments:

• Sensitivity.

• Hold time.

• Detection mode.

• Pedestrian and parallel traffic rejection mode.

• Relay configuration.

Temperature range : -22°F to 122°F (-30°C to +60°C)
Degree of protection: IP65
Product conformity:

R&TTE 1999/5/EC

EMC

89/336/EEC

Dimensions : 5 in (D) x 4 in (W) x 3 ¾ (H)

(127mm (D) x 102 mm (W) x 96mm (H))

Weight:

0.88 lbs (400 g)

Housing Material:

ABS and Polycarbonate

Bracket Material:

black anodized aluminum

Cable length:

33 ft (10 m)

Cable diameter:

1/8” (3 mm) (minimum)

1/4” (6.5 mm) (maximum)



















The sensor must be firmly
fastened in order not to
vibrate.

The sensor must not be
placed directly behind a
panel or any kind of
material.

The sensor must not
have any object likely to
move or vibrate in its
sensing field.

The sensor must not
have any fluorescent
lighting in its sensing
field.
